Crime overview

Hulme Street area has the 29th highest crime rate of 103 local areas in Crewe Central , and the 146th highest crime rate of 1,268 local areas in Cheshire East .

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.

The overall crime rate in the area around Hulme Street (CW1 3PB) in the last 12 months was 131.7 per 1,000 residents and was 51.7% lower than the Crewe Central average (272.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 30 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Vehicle crime ( -66.7%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 32 (≈ 89.6 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-3.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 37.6%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Hulme Street (CW1 3PB), the main crime hotspot is near Fairburn Avenue. Police recorded 46 crimes here, including 32 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
